How Condo Location Impacts Cell Service Reception

Shifting the focus to the influence of your condominium’s location on cell service, it’s clear that numerous factors come into play. The neighborhood’s topography, proximity to cellphone towers, and the density of surrounding buildings can all affect the quality of your cellphone service provider’s network coverage for condominiums.

Here are some key considerations:

  • Proximity to Cell Towers: Generally, the closer your condo is to a cell tower, the stronger your reception will be.
  • Terrain: Hills, valleys, and bodies of water can obstruct cell signals.
  • Urban Density: In densely populated urban areas, buildings can interfere with cell signals.
  • Building Construction: Materials used in your condo construction can either impede or facilitate cell signals.
  • In-building Interference: Electronic devices within your condo can also disrupt cell signals.

How to Determine if It’s an Outage or Something Else

If your residential complex is frequently plagued by dropped calls, it could be due to factors beyond your control. To verify whether it’s an area-wide outage or a different issue, consult with the Cellphone Service Providers Network Coverage for Condominiums. If other residents in your vicinity are also experiencing problems, it’s likely a network outage. Otherwise, your device may be faulty or there might be interference from large appliances within your condo. You can also check with your provider for any reported outages in your area.

FAQ

1. Why is cellphone service coverage important in condominiums?

Cellphone service coverage is crucial in condominiums as it enables communication, convenience, and safety. A good cell signal ensures uninterrupted daily activities and quicker emergency responses.

2. How do building materials affect cell signals?

Certain building materials such as brick, metal, and concrete can notably weaken cell signals. Large electronic devices can also create electromagnetic interference which can contribute to poor reception.

3. How does a condo’s location impact cell service reception?

The geographical location and surrounding terrain of a condominium can significantly influence signal strength. The condo’s proximity to cell towers and the surrounding landscape, including hills, valleys, and urban structures, play a critical role.

4. How can I enhance poor cellphone service in my condo?

If you’re experiencing poor cell service, cell signal boosters can be a good solution as they amplify weak signals, thus improving reception. If boosters aren’t sufficient, you might need to consider switching to a different service provider that offers better coverage in your area.

5. What should I do if I’m considering moving into a new condo?

Before moving into a new condo, it’s important to check the cell coverage. You can do this during condo tours or use websites and apps that display coverage maps. This will allow you to avoid potential signal issues and frustrations in the future.
